gammongaming11

there was back in 1, and they brought him back in 7. iirc they spent a lot of money for the original voice cast in yakuza1, they even got mark hammil (and it ended up being a financial disaster and the reason 2-6 didn't get dubs). personally i will never understand why anyone would use dubs for a game like yakuza (or dubs in general) but i can't deny that having dubs makes games/anime much more accessible to a wider audience and are associated with more sales.
